[Studies on chemical constituents of Caesalpinia decapetala (Roth) Alston].

Maoxing Li1, Chenzhong Zhang, Li Chong.   

Abstract

OBJECTIVE: To study the chemical constituents from Caesalpinia decapetala (Roth) Alston.
METHODS: Chromatography and spectroscopic analysis were employed to isolate and elucidate the chemical constituents in the plant.
RESULTS: Seven compounds were isolated and elucidated as lupeol acetate(I), lupeol(II), oleanoic acid(III), pentacosanoic acid 2,3-dihydroxypropyl ester(IV), 1-(26-hydroxyhexacosanoyl)-glycerol(V), stigmasterol(VI), beta-sitosterol(VI).
CONCLUSION: I approximattely VII were isolated from this plant for the first time.
